Hike the easy 3.3-mile Rosewood Trail in Ventu Park Open Space, gaining 728 feet with panoramic views from Angel Vista.

Angel Vista Viewpoint

Highlight • Viewpoint

At the end of the Rosewood Trail, and atop Ventu Park, you reach Angel Vista. This lookout point provides 360 desgree views of the open space and has a descent amount of shade reaching this point.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does it typically take to hike this trail?

The Rosewood Trail is approximately 5.2 kilometers (3.25 miles) long and generally takes about 1 hour and 40 minutes to complete as a hike. This duration can vary depending on your pace and how long you spend enjoying the viewpoints.

What is the terrain like on the Rosewood Trail?

The trail presents a moderate challenge with a consistent climb up a hill, though switchbacks help manage the steepness. The surface can be uneven in places, and it's a multi-use path, so be aware of other hikers and bikers. Despite the climb, komoot rates the overall difficulty as easy.

Are there any notable viewpoints or landmarks along the route?

Yes, a key highlight is the Angel Vista Viewpoint. This ridge-top location offers expansive panoramic views of the surrounding landscape and is a great spot to take a break and enjoy the scenery.

Does this trail connect with other hiking paths?

Yes, the Rosewood Trail connects to other paths in the area. The route also passes through sections of the Los Robles Trail, offering options for longer hikes and exploring more of the Ventu Park Open Space network.

What should I bring for a hike on the Rosewood Trail?

Given the consistent climb and potential for uneven surfaces, sturdy hiking shoes are recommended. Always carry enough water, especially on warmer days, as there may not be water sources directly on the trail. Sun protection like a hat and sunscreen is also advisable.

Is the Rosewood Trail suitable for beginners?

While the trail involves a consistent climb and is rated as a moderate challenge by some, komoot classifies it as an 'easy' hike. The presence of switchbacks helps manage the steepness, making it accessible for beginners who are prepared for some uphill effort.
